After a Decade, Brazil to Return: USA vs. Brazil — June 27, 2026

Newport, Rhode Island, USA - The Newport International Polo Series proudly announces one of the most anticipated matches of its 35th season: USA vs. Brazil, taking place at 5:00 PM on Saturday, June 27, 2026. The match is part of the Club’s 150th Diamond Jubilee, commemorating a century and a half since the introduction of polo to America in Newport, Rhode Island.


Brazil’s return to Newport is a moment of great significance, as the nation rejoins the Series after an eleven-year hiatus. Victorious in its debut appearance in 2011 and narrowly defeated in its second match in 2015, Brazil now returns with determination and pride, aiming to secure its second title in the Newport International Polo Series and reaffirm its place among the world’s leading polo nations.


Renowned for its excellence in polo and its internationally ranked players, Brazil brings a dynamic and highly competitive presence to the field. Representing the esteemed Sociedade Hípica Paulista of São Paulo, the team features players with numerous titles under their belt and diverse international experience. Team captain José de Sá will mark his return to New England as a former graduate of Cornell University Graduate School, adding a meaningful personal connection to this international contest.


The Opening Ceremony will feature the Brazilian national anthem and the raising of Brazil’s flag at centerfield alongside that of the United States, honoring the Brazilian delegation and celebrating the enduring friendship between the two countries. Since 1992, the Newport International Polo Series has welcomed teams from around the world, promoting goodwill and cultural exchange through sport. Brazil’s participation in the 2026 season underscores this mission and highlights the strong ties between the international polo community and Brazilian sport.


During their visit, the Brazilian delegation will be hosted in Newport, an historic seaside city celebrated for its architectural beauty, maritime heritage, and longstanding role in American sport and culture. A series of associated events throughout the weekend will further foster cultural exchange and international camaraderie.


Gates will open early, inviting guests to enjoy an afternoon of entertainment, hospitality, and picnicking in the scenic setting of the polo grounds ahead of the 5:00 PM match.


This event is presented as a tribute to Brazil’s rich sporting tradition and to the unifying power of international competition. The 2026 season will also feature teams from Mongolia, Italy, Ireland, South Africa, Jamaica, England, and Switzerland, with matches held every Saturday from June through September.
